My Project
This school year I was moved to teach in a 3rd grade classroom! I previously taught kindergarten for two years. As I was putting my classroom library together, I saw that I did not have many books for my students, especially in Spanish.
By donating to our project, you will help my students enhance their native language and improve their academic achievements throughout their education.
My students enjoy reading books but are getting kind of sad that they do not have many books to choose from. These books will make a big difference in my students lives because they will have the opportunity to read books they enjoy and that are in their native language.
